  DSI code for VBT has a set of ugly GPIO hacks, one of which is direct
talking to GPIO IP behind the actual driver's back. A second attempt
to fix that is here.

If I understood correctly, my approach should work in the similar way as
the current IOSF GPIO.

Hans, I believe you have some devices that use this piece of code,
is it possible to give a test run on (one of) them?

In v3:
- incorporated series by Jani
- incorporated couple of precursor patches by Hans
- added Rb tag for used to be first three patches (Andi)
- rebased on top of the above changes
- fixed indexing for multi-community devices, such as Cherry View

In v2:
- added a few cleanup patches
- reworked to use dynamic GPIO lookup tables
- converted CHV as well
